Picking the best Pallet Rack system is one of the most essential choices a warehouse or circulation center can make. In several procedures, the storage rack system becomes the backbone of day-to-day motion, connecting receiving, storage, order selecting, and shipping in one coordinated circulation.A Pallet Rack is commonly the very first remedy organizations consider because it is functional, scalable, and compatible with lots of types of inventory. It enables pallets to be stored off the floor in organized rows, making it simpler for forklifts to place and fetch loads securely. For storage facilities taking care of fast-moving durable goods, commercial components, food and beverage items, or seasonal stock, the basic pallet storage framework is a sensible starting point. It can be adjusted to various ceiling heights, aisle sizes, and pallet sizes, that makes it beneficial for both little storage spaces and huge logistics facilities. As procedures grow, the exact same system can usually be expanded or reconfigured rather than changed totally.
The value of a warehouse rack system exceeds easy storage. Good rack layout sustains inventory control by producing clear locations for each SKU, reducing complication and aiding workers find things much faster. It likewise enhances product protection by maintaining products off the floor and far from moisture, contamination, or accidental damages. In busy centers, the best rack layout can minimize travel time for pickers and forklifts, which helps boost throughput. When a storage rack is matched correctly to item weight, dealing with method, and turn over rate, it can dramatically improve both safety and security and productivity.

Medium Duty Shelving offers a different need. While not planned for heavy palletized lots, it is well fit for cartons, components, tools, and carefully picked stock. Several warehouses utilize medium shelving in pick components, maintenance spaces, archives, and e-commerce procedures where items are accessed manually instead of with forklifts. This type of Steel Rack framework can help organize smaller sized products in a tidy, easily accessible layout that supports fast retrieval and precise order fulfillment. In facilities that take care of both loosened and palletized items, integrating pallet storage with shelving can develop a more balanced and reliable workspace.
An AGV Rack is developed with automated led automobiles in mind, supporting product flow with precise measurements, steady lots placement, and compatible accessibility points. A rack system constructed for automation needs to be aligned very carefully with car guidance, pallet problem, tons uniformity, and warehouse control procedures.
Radio Shuttle Racking offers an additional path to greater storage thickness. Rather than driving forklifts right into rack lanes, a powered shuttle brings pallets within the storage channels. This aids decrease forklift travel right into deep lanes while enhancing the performance of small storage. Radio shuttle systems are often chosen for high-volume environments with big quantities of comparable products, specifically where first-in, first-out or last-in, first-out circulation techniques have to be carefully handled. Because the shuttle deals with the inner motion inside the rack, drivers can load and obtain pallets much faster than with deep drive-in plans, while still obtaining substantial area financial savings.
Automated storage and access systems utilize machinery to area and obtain items with precision, reducing hand-operated labor and improving uniformity. These systems are typically paired with software-driven stock control and can be especially useful in operations with high throughput, minimal floor room, or strict precision demands.

Space use is typically one of the main factors firms update or upgrade their rack systems. Expanding upward instead of outward can help maintain beneficial floor area and decrease the requirement for center moving. A warehouse rack system that makes use of upright area efficiently can improve storage capacity without requiring a bigger building footprint. At the same time, managers have to stabilize density with access. Exceptionally thick systems can minimize the number of available pallet positions or require customized handling devices. The right equilibrium relies on product velocity and just how typically inventory requires to be accessed.
Safety needs to stay main in any rack choice. A Steel Rack should be engineered and mounted to take care of intended tons and daily handling conditions. Straining, incorrect pallet positioning, impact from forklifts, and poor upkeep can all develop hazards. Clear aisle widths, rack security, light beam locking systems, and routine evaluations are all vital parts of a safe storage atmosphere. It is likewise smart to prepare for future modification, because stock patterns often develop gradually. A system that can adjust to brand-new items, brand-new tools, or raised volume is usually a better long-lasting investment than one developed only for present requirements.
The most effective rack systems also sustain process effectiveness. In many warehouses, the format impacts how much forklifts or employees have to take a trip during each change. An efficient Pallet Rack system can decrease blockage and enhance traffic circulation, particularly when receiving and delivering zones are plainly defined. In procedures with high pick frequency, placing fast-moving products in accessible areas and slower-moving items in denser storage can enhance productivity. Medium Duty Shelving might be placed near packing terminals for small components, while drive-in lanes or shuttle storage may be scheduled for bulk reserves. This type of strategic planning aids the warehouse function as an incorporated system as opposed to a collection of separate storage areas.
Production centers may call for a mix of pallet storage, parts shelving, and long-item storage with Cantilever Racking. Ecommerce procedures commonly count on a mix of storage rack kinds to sustain both bulk books and order picking. Each business has its very own account, and the rack system ought to reflect those operational facts.
Setup and maintenance are also crucial. If it is set up incorrectly or not kept correctly, even a top notch warehouse rack will execute poorly. Degree floors, exact measurements, correct anchoring where called for, and tons signs all add to a secure atmosphere. With time, rack systems ought to be evaluated for bent uprights, harmed beams, missing out on components, or indications of duplicated influence. Preventive upkeep helps safeguard both the equipment and individuals that work around it. In hectic centers, even small damages can become a significant issue if it is neglected.
